Diffraction appears as a pattern of light and dark fringes or bands when waves, such as light or sound, encounter an obstacle or pass through a narrow opening. This bending and spreading of waves create a series of constructive and destructive interference patterns. In optics, diffraction can be seen as a colorful halo around light sources or as patterns on surfaces when light passes through slits. Overall, it showcases the wave nature of light and other forms of radiation.
